Under its original policy, a champion earned championship recognition in the ring, defeating the preceding champion or winning a bout between its top rated contenders. Lineal Heavyweight Champion. In 1920 a de facto minimum weight for a heavyweight was set at 175 pounds (12 st 7lb, 79kg) with the standardization of a weight limit for the light heavyweight division. The rise of sanctioning organizations, however, have produced an environment where typically there is no single world heavyweight champion, with titleholders recognized by one of these organizations (a "World Champion") or more (a "Super Champion," a "Unified Champion," or, in the rare cases where the four most prominent organizations recognize the same boxer, an "Undisputed Champion"). In time, each organization would have its own spin-off sanctioning organization break from its ranks: the United States Boxing Association, which disassociated with the WBA in the late 1970s and became the International Boxing Federation in 1983, and the World Boxing Organization, whose members would split from the WBC in 1988.
